14:22 — Priya confirmed the Quillbase edge nodes were serving responses cached before the schema change, explaining the stale author fields. She flushed the Renfold cluster manually and verified fresh reads within ninety seconds. Reviewers should note the invalidation hook never fired because the deploy skipped the warmup stage. The offending deploy is identified by the token below.

trace token, fafog-kageg: htk4_98e6

## 3.8.2 — Signing Key Rotation for the Tallyford Import Wizard

Rotated the release signing key for the CSV import wizard after the previous key passed its scheduled expiry. All artifacts from 3.8.2 onward are signed with the new key; builds 3.7.x and earlier remain verifiable against the archived key in the vault. Future maintainers should update CI verification settings before cutting any release. The active signing key is recorded below.

rollout seal: bky4_x7Gc

# Env Vars: Planner Regression Mitigation

After the query planner regression in Corvid DB 9.3, Fernwell's release builds must pin the legacy planner until the patched build ships. Set `CORVID_PLANNER_MODE=legacy` in the release env file and confirm it with the preflight check before tagging. The planner override endpoint requires authentication, so the release env file also needs the planner override token on the next line.

env line for kahof-fajeg: ARCHIVE_KEY3=397

Hello plugin authors,

As part of our quarterly security cycle at Moraine Softworks, we are rotating credentials for BreakerGate, the circuit-breaker layer that protects calls to the upstream Tidewell API. Plugins that query breaker state or trip thresholds must switch to the new credential before the old one is revoked next Friday. No endpoint paths or response formats change; only the credential does. Please update your configuration promptly and re-run your integration checks. The replacement key is below.

app token of yahop-fafof = kto3_p5z